Artificial Intelligence for Space Startups and Businesses

UMNAI’s co-founder Angelo Dalli is holding a series of AI deeptech workshops on applying AI within space applications, aimed at startups and businesses looking to enter into space applications. Held as part of the ESA and EBAN Space Academy, various presentations in France, Italy and Germany will be held as an online series with live audience participation.

Angelo explores the long history of AI advances in space, which is still gaining a foothold as AI capabilities become more advanced. Looking at different applications, including remote control, remote assistance, maintenance, hardened hardware, ground control applications, spacecraft operations, in-space processing and the ever growing opportunities for AI in space, the workshop offers a comprehensive 360 degree look at how deeptech is changing space exploration and commercial applications. An in-depth dive into autonomous terrain tracking and sampling is complimented by an explanation of how UMNAI’s Neuro-Symbolic explainable AI models can be used to provide realtime assistance where communication delays are crucial, and where resource constraints constrict the variety and type of AI models that can be deployed. A brief overview of how transparent white-box AI models can achieve power and resource optimization without compromising performance rounds off the workshop.

Held in conjunction with 111 Holdings, the European Space Agency (ESA), and the European Business Angel Network (EBAN).
